Abstract
We are talking about racial preferences, the practice of racial discrimination; apart from that, there is no controversy and nothing to debate. "Affirmative action" has become simply a deceptive label for racial preferences. The central question presented, therefore, is whether government and government supported institutions should grant preference to some individuals, and thereby necessarily disfavor others, on the basis of race.
